Blog Image

Do You Know About These Mountains That Exist Undersea?

Do you know how the title of the tallest mountain in the world is usually indisputably handed to Mt Everest? Turns out it does have a rivalling opponent — Mauna Kea. The only factor that stops it from claiming this title: about half of it is located underwater. The oceans are absolutely intriguing in every way possible and today, we are listing mountains that exist undersea. By Quoyina Ghosh